Sat 765354041535216

decimal
153070.4041535216
degree
0°153070′1870″4041535216‴
percentile
36.44543058938599%
name
ikuczdynsaz
cycle
0
epoch
0
period
75
block
153070
offset
4041535216
timestamp
rarity
common